Default Coupe Weatherstrip Replacement

When I removed the top this weekend a chunk of the weatherstripping on the rear part of the car (not the roof) came off . I then found several tears in the weatherstripping . I have seen this part for sale at most of the C-5 vendors but, have not been able to find instructions for removal and replacement. Has any one out there made this repair? Do you have instructions?

Got it!

Removal Procedure

1. Remove the removable roof panel.

2. Remove the push-in retainers from the lower ends of the rear weatherstrip.
3. Remove the screws from the upper corners of the rear weatherstrip.
4. Remove the rear weatherstrip by pulling from the retainers.
5. Inspect the weatherstrip for rips or tears. Replace if ripped or torn.

Installation Procedure

1. Apply a 6 mm (0.25 in) X 100 mm (4 in) bead of thumb grade sealer to the roof bow and lock pillar overlapping the side retainer as shown.

2. Peel the protective film from the foam tape on the new weatherstrip, or install two sided tape to a reused weatherstrip.
3. Position the rear roof weatherstrip to the retainers on the roof bow.
4. Insert the weatherstrip into the center retainer working from the center outward.

Notice

Use the correct fastener in the correct location. Replacement fasteners must be the correct part number for that application. Fasteners requiring replacement or fasteners requiring the use of thread locking compound or sealant are identified in the service procedure. Do not use paints, lubricants, or corrosion inhibitors on fasteners or fastener joint surfaces unless specified. These coatings affect fastener torque and joint clamping force and may damage the fastener. Use the correct tightening sequence and specifications when installing fasteners in order to avoid damage to parts and systems.

5. Install the screws into the upper corners of the rear weatherstrip. Tighten
Tighten the roof weatherstrip upper corner screws to 3.4 N·m (30 lb in).

6. Insert the rear weatherstrip into the side retainers starting at the upper corners and working downward.
7. Install the push in fasteners at the lower ends of the rear weatherstrip.


8. Install the roof panel.
